How they compare

Nicaragua currently reports 101 1000 USD against 64 1000 USD in Jamaica, a difference of 37 1000 USD.

That makes Nicaragua's figure about 1.6 times Jamaica's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 12 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Jamaica ahead.

Jamaica ranks 32nd and Nicaragua ranks 30th of 57 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Jamaica averaged higher in 1 and Nicaragua in 2.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
